银行编程用什么语言
银行编程难:挑战与应对措施
作为金融行业的重要组成部分,银行业的编程任务确实充满了挑战。从安全性要求到复杂的金融产品,银行编程面临着诸多难题。以下是关于银行编程的一些讨论和应对措施。
难题一:安全性要求
银行作为负责保管客户财富的机构,对安全性有着极高的要求。因此,银行编程不仅需要满足常规的软件安全标准,还需要符合金融行业的专业安全标准,比如PCI DSS、ISO 27001等。为了保障交易安全和客户数据的保密,银行系统需要具备高度的防护机制,包括数据加密、访问控制、安全审计等。
应对措施
:银行编程人员需要严格遵守安全编程最佳实践,采用最新的安全技术,定期进行安全审计和漏洞扫描,确保系统安全性达到行业标准。难题二:复杂的金融产品

银行业涉及的金融产品种类繁多,从简单的储蓄账户到复杂的衍生品交易,每种产品都需要相应的编程支持。不同金融产品涉及的计算、风险管理、报表等方面都有不同的要求,这给银行编程带来了巨大的挑战。
应对措施
:银行编程团队需要充分理解各种金融产品的特点,与业务部门紧密合作,制定灵活的架构和模块化的编程方案,以便适应不断变化的金融产品需求。难题三:遗留系统与现代化需求
许多银行的核心系统是在几十年前开发的,这些遗留系统通常面临技术老化、难以维护和扩展的问题。与此银行业务在数字化转型的推动下对系统的现代化需求也日益增长,这就需要银行编程团队在保证遗留系统稳定性的推动系统的现代化改造。
应对措施
:银行编程团队需要对遗留系统进行深入分析,制定合理的现代化改造方案,包括系统重构、技术更新、微服务化改造等,同时确保现代化改造过程对业务的无缝过渡。难题四:合规和监管要求
银行业受监管的程度较高,需要符合诸多合规要求,如AML(反洗钱)、KYC(了解你的客户)等。银行编程不仅需要满足业务需求,还需要确保系统能够满足监管机构的要求,这增加了银行编程的复杂性。
应对措施
:银行编程团队需要加强与合规和监管部门的沟通,了解最新的法规要求,将合规要求纳入系统设计和开发过程中,确保系统在满足监管要求的同时能够高效支持业务。银行编程的难度在于需要兼顾安全、复杂的金融产品、遗留系统现代化和合规监管要求等诸多方面。只有银行编程团队保持敏锐的业务洞察力、创新的思维和与时俱进的技术能力,才能应对这些挑战,为银行业务的高效运行提供有力的支持。
本文 新鼎系統网 原创,转载保留链接!网址:https://acs-product.com/post/12239.html
免责声明:本网站部分内容由用户自行上传,若侵犯了您的权益,请联系我们处理,谢谢!联系QQ:2760375052 版权所有:新鼎系統网沪ICP备2023024866号-15